Subject: Pagination cut-over complete

Hi team,

Welcome aboard. Last night we finished migrating the Fernwave public REST API from offset-based to cursor-based pagination. All v2 endpoints now return an opaque cursor token, and offset parameters are silently ignored as of this release. Clients on the old scheme were notified twice and traffic has fully shifted. For reference during reviews, the new pagination settings applied to production are as follows.

deployment values, yadup-kadug:
[sorys]
port = 5672
team = noveth
host = sorys.orvexcorp.example
region = south-4
access_code = ac_deddc1
timeout_ms = 1500

**Key Ceremony Checklist — Item 7 (Passflow Revamp)**

Before cutting over the revamped password reset flow in Passflow, the on-call engineer must verify that both ceremony witnesses have signed the attestation sheet and that the old reset-token signing key has been marked retired in the Bramblewood HSM console. Confirm the audit recorder is running. Then seal the ceremony envelope using the recovery passphrase below.

recovery phrase for baweg-faweg: zorael-framir

Subject: Quickstore 4.2 — bloom filter now fronts the KV layer

Plugin authors: starting with this release, Quickstore places a bloom filter ahead of the key-value store. Negative lookups return faster; false positives fall through safely. No API changes are required on your side. Verify your plugin against the staging build referenced below.

session token of fahif-tadup = htk3_9c7

Title: Scheduler double-waters bed 3 after DST shift

New folks: the Verdella scheduler stores watering slots in local time. After the clock change, slot 06:00 fires twice, soaking the herb bed. Fix: store UTC, convert at display. Repro on the Oakhollow test rig only. To reproduce, install the firmware identified by the token below.

build token for hafop-kahog: htk31_a432ac515d5bb1362002c1e1a7e80ef